Drywall bull nose around a window


Does any one know how to cut and hang window bull nose bead properly?

Drywall bull nose around a window


You install it just like normal vinyl corner bead. Use spray adhesive and a T-50 hand stapler if necessary.

Measure, cut, install...coat and sand.

Coat the bead to the indentation line that is before the outside edge of the corner. You don't actually coat the rounded part of the bead, rather, it's left exposed. Use a sanding sponge when sanding it.

Drywall bull nose around a window


First you need to put the corners on (2-way bullnose corners) then cut the bead and you can nail it(metal) or staple it(vinyl) but make sure you duece them next to each other.
